Volunteer Appreciation Dessert

Tuesday, September 15
7:00 pm, Red Lion on Coburg Road
All Hope Chapel Volunteers are Invited

Hope Chapel has a vision to introduce people to the love and grace of Jesus, help them mature in that relationship, and be the hands and feet of the Lord in our community and beyond. None of this can happen without the commitment and sacrifice of time, talents, and effort of volunteers in the Hope family.

During any given week we have dozens of people who volunteer in a variety of roles - people who teach, greet, clean, set up, serve, produce, lead worship, stock shelves and sort clothes, coordinate, mentor... the list is practically endless. We'd like to spend an evening honoring our volunteers and remembering why we do the things we do. If you are one of those volunteers, please join us at this special event.
